Laurel D. Roglen, a partner in Ballard Spahr’s Bankruptcy, Creditors’ Rights, and Restructuring Group, has been named to the 2025 40 Under 40 list of the American Bankruptcy Institute (ABI), a premier national organization of accomplished bankruptcy professionals.
ABI’s 2025 40 Under 40 list includes honorees from across professional disciplines—including attorneys, judges, trustees, accountants, financial advisers, academics, and researchers—“who demonstrate remarkable ability, leadership, and achievement in the bankruptcy and insolvency community” and “are distinguished by professional achievements and service.” Honorees were selected by a group of experienced insolvency professionals.
Laurel and her fellow awardees will be recognized during the ABI's Winter Leadership Conference in December in Tucson, Arizona.
Based in Ballard Spahr’s office in Wilmington, Delaware, Laurel represents large, national corporations and other clients in bankruptcy and restructuring, commercial bankruptcy, and workout and restructuring matters. The firm’s Bankruptcy and Restructuring Group is known nationally for its successful handling of complex, high-profile cases coast to coast—from corporate restructurings, including Chapter 11 debtor and creditor matters, to distressed real estate, distressed transactions, and Chapter 9 municipal insolvencies for major U.S. cities.
